# hash-files This action is to compute the SHA256 hash of specified files. The hash function is based on [nektos/act](https://github.com/nektos/act/blob/ac5dd8feb876d37ae483376a137c57383577dace/pkg/exprparser/functions.go#L183). Thanks! **NOTE:** This action is written in Go. Please setup the Go environment before running this action or use a runner with Go environment installed. ## Usage ``` yml - uses: seepine/hash-files@v1 with: # The working dir for the action. # Default: ${{ github.workspace }} workdir: '' # The patterns used to match files. patterns: '**/package-lock.json' # Multiple patterns should be seperated by `\n` patterns: | **/package-lock.json **/yarn.lock ``` ## Input |Output Item|Description|Required|Default| |---|---|---|---| |workdir|The working dir for the action|false|${{ github.workspace }}| |patterns|The patterns used to match files|true|| |gitignore|Respect ignore patterns in .gitignore files that apply to the globbed files.|false|true |ignoreFiles|Glob patterns to look for ignore files, which are then used to ignore globbed files.|false| ## Output |Output Item|Description| |---|---| |hash|The computed hash result| |matched-files|The files matched by the patterns| ## Example ``` yml # Setup the Node environment. This step can be skipped if Node has been installed. - uses: actions/setup-node@v3 - uses: seepine/hash-files@v1 id: get-hash with: patterns: | **/package-lock.json **/yarn.lock - name: Echo hash run: echo ${{ steps.get-hash.outputs.hash }} ```
